I am trying to convert format from compatability mode to doc. When I try to
use office button, nothing is highlighted to click on except. Open. How do
I get the office button to open correctly? Pat

If a header bar says "compatibility mode," then the file that's
showing _is_ in .doc format. If the Save etc. options aren't
available, then you haven't yet made any changes for it to save.

Do you have Windows set to not display file extensions?

The Office button is context sensitive. In order for the buttons other than
open/new to be active you have to have a document open. For the Convert
button to be available the open document must be doc format. All doc format
files will open in compatibility mode. Word 2007 format is docx/m.
